kernel: rename reserved symbol 'remove'
This symbol is reserved and usage of reserved symbols violates the coding guidelines. (MISRA 21.2) NAME remove - remove a file or directory SYNOPSIS #include <stdio.h> int remove(const char *pathname); Signed-off-by: Anas Nashif <anas.nashif@intel.com>
This commit is contained in:
parent
eafc6c067f
commit
669f7f74b8
1 changed files with 5 additions and 5 deletions
|
@ -148,22 +148,22 @@ static inline void register_event(struct k_poll_event *event,
|
||||||
/* must be called with interrupts locked */
|
/* must be called with interrupts locked */
|
||||||
static inline void clear_event_registration(struct k_poll_event *event)
|
static inline void clear_event_registration(struct k_poll_event *event)
|
||||||
{
|
{
|
||||||
bool remove = false;
|
bool remove_event = false;
|
||||||
|
|
||||||
event->poller = NULL;
|
event->poller = NULL;
|
||||||
|
|
||||||
switch (event->type) {
|
switch (event->type) {
|
||||||
case K_POLL_TYPE_SEM_AVAILABLE:
|
case K_POLL_TYPE_SEM_AVAILABLE:
|
||||||
__ASSERT(event->sem != NULL, "invalid semaphore\n");
|
__ASSERT(event->sem != NULL, "invalid semaphore\n");
|
||||||
remove = true;
|
remove_event = true;
|
||||||
break;
|
break;
|
||||||
case K_POLL_TYPE_DATA_AVAILABLE:
|
case K_POLL_TYPE_DATA_AVAILABLE:
|
||||||
__ASSERT(event->queue != NULL, "invalid queue\n");
|
__ASSERT(event->queue != NULL, "invalid queue\n");
|
||||||
remove = true;
|
remove_event = true;
|
||||||
break;
|
break;
|
||||||
case K_POLL_TYPE_SIGNAL:
|
case K_POLL_TYPE_SIGNAL:
|
||||||
__ASSERT(event->signal != NULL, "invalid poll signal\n");
|
__ASSERT(event->signal != NULL, "invalid poll signal\n");
|
||||||
remove = true;
|
remove_event = true;
|
||||||
break;
|
break;
|
||||||
case K_POLL_TYPE_IGNORE:
|
case K_POLL_TYPE_IGNORE:
|
||||||
/* nothing to do */
|
/* nothing to do */
|
||||||
|
@ -172,7 +172,7 @@ static inline void clear_event_registration(struct k_poll_event *event)
|
||||||
__ASSERT(false, "invalid event type\n");
|
__ASSERT(false, "invalid event type\n");
|
||||||
break;
|
break;
|
||||||
}
|
}
|
||||||
if (remove && sys_dnode_is_linked(&event->_node)) {
|
if (remove_event && sys_dnode_is_linked(&event->_node)) {
|
||||||
sys_dlist_remove(&event->_node);
|
sys_dlist_remove(&event->_node);
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
Loading…
Add table
Add a link
Reference in a new issue